Neterion's Xframe 10 Gigabit Ethernet Adapters Selected by Fujitsu for PRIMEQUEST Family of Servers

Leading Japanese Server Vendor Selects Xframe for its Unique Feature Set and Performance

Cupertino, California and Tokyo, Japan — October 16, 2007 Neterion, Inc., the industry leader in 10 Gigabit Ethernet (10 GbE) adapters for server and storage environments, announced that Neterion's Xframe® II 10 Gigabit Ethernet adapter has been qualified and selected by Fujitsu Limited for its high-end PRIMEQUEST™ line of Itanium-based industry-standard servers. Xframe® II is a member of the family of 10 GbE Xframe V-NIC™ adapters designed to provide virtualization functions at the I/O level.

"PRIMEQUEST is one of the world's most highly reliable server platforms and addresses mission critical applications in every major vertical market," said Mr. Takato Noda, General Manager of Mission Critical IA Server Development Department of Fujitsu Limited. "With end users constantly requiring increased performance from their servers, we are pleased that Neterion was able to meet our very demanding qualification process and will help us to meet the high performance requirements that customers have come to expect from Fujitsu."

The Xframe II adapter includes support for Microsoft Windows Server™, VMware, Red Hat and Novell SUSE Linux, among other environments.

"We are very proud to announce our selection by Fujitsu," stated Dave Zabrowski, president & CEO of Neterion. "10 Gigabit Ethernet boosts I/O performance to a new level and makes Fujitsu PRIMEQUEST a very competitive platform for I/O intensive, mission critical applications. The launch of a 10 Gigabit Ethernet option by a leading server vendor in Japan clearly indicates that this technology is gaining rapid traction worldwide, and is becoming a key enabler to server consolidation."

With the announcement of this agreement, Neterion now has OEM or distribution relationships with major server and storage vendors on a worldwide basis including Fujitsu, Hitachi, IBM, HP, EMC, Sun Microsystems, Cray and Silicon Graphics.

Hitachi High Technologies, the exclusive distributor in Japan for the Neterion family of Xframe V-NIC™ 10 Gigabit Ethernet adapters and integrated circuits, played a key role in this new OEM selection.

About Neterion
Neterion is the leader in 10 Gigabit Ethernet adapters that provide high speed solutions for customers' server and storage networks. With their unique Hyperframe architecture, Neterion's Xframe V-NIC adapters feature independent physical paths, built into the hardware to offer optimal performance and security in virtualized environments. This enables IT managers to implement end-to-end virtualization down to the I/O level. The company was founded in 2001 and is headquartered in Cupertino, California with an additional office in Ottawa, Canada.
